AROUND TOWN

Lunchbreak (Mon-Thu)
This summer, parkgoers can catch noontime acts every day of the week. Hear jazz, blues and beyond (Monday); open rehearsals (Tuesday); brass (Wednesday); rock and pop (Thursday); Chicago house (Friday); electric (Saturday); and American roots (Sundays).

Cirque Shanghai Extreme (Wed)
Catch this summertime staple before it ends on labor day. New for 2011 are a Shaolin kung fu sword-fighting sequence (shhhink!) and a high-wire motorcycle stunt. 

Say It Like You Mean It Summer Tour (Wed)
Soccer moms, hold on to your minivans. Daytime TV's Wendy Williams Show invades a suburban mall near you. On this 17-city promotional tour, the comedic host serves up her usual strong opinions and sassy humor.

Truckin' Thursdays (Thu)
The mobile food biz is on a roll. Stop by Chicago Food Trucks' weekly assembly of delectables. The week's assortment might include Gaztro-wagon, Meatyballs Mobile, Southern Mac Truck, Fido-to Go (for pooches) and other vendors peddling their edibles.

Chicago Dancing Festival (all week)
Even though this fest of international dance companies is free, most tickets sold out faster than organizer Lar Lubovitch can plié. Performers include New York’s Doug Varone & Dancers, Aspen Santa Fe Ballet, rising choreographer Adam Barruch, Hubbard Street Dance Chicago and Richard Move. See Dance for more.
